Before you email

Six Things That Make A Brief Usable.

  1. The magazine title, issue date and final artwork deadline.
  2. The page size, column width, house style and any print colour limits.
  3. The data as CSV, XLSX, Google Sheet export or clearly typed source material.
  4. Source links, report names and the editor signing off interpretation.
  5. The intended use: chart redraw, infographic, map, table, timeline or full-page feature.
  6. Any web crops required after print approval.

Availability board

Normal Lead Times And Rush Rule.

Clean chart

Single chart redraws from supplied data are normally 2 working days.

Price
£180 to £260 + VAT
Choose format

Infographic

Half-page infographics and process diagrams are normally 4 to 6 working days.

Price
£420 to £650 + VAT
Read process

Full-page feature

Research tidy-up and print artwork for a feature page is normally 7 to 10 working days.

Price
£850 to £1,450 + VAT
See archive

Rush work

Inside 24 hours is +35% where the brief and data are complete before 11:00am.

Minimum
£180 + VAT
